i had a plain 72 ring drop with very good stats(phy+93% mag+53%).

It was a pity cos i was already done with my rings, both pimped +4 with 20% almost all the important status and int5, str4/3. The % are average though, +22%

I decided to keep the new ring for a while to try pimp it up a bit. i was thinking if this ring cooperated in alchemy, i might replace one of my current rings. i started with the cheaper stones, threw in about 6-7 fire stones, 2-3 zombie stones. Final result 1% burn :roll: no assim tho luckily. but i was losing my patience.

this morning when i woke, someone pm in stall offering to buy it for 3mill, we negotiated and i finally sold for 4mill. thinking back now, somehow kinda regretted. it could have beena great ring if i persevered. should i have sold it? i dunno, what u guys think?

yeah you're right. The thing about jewelry is that, theres only so few things you can assim. Its either phy or mag, nothing else. The chance of screwing up is so high. Thats why my strategy was add as many crappy blue stats as i could so that the assim monster would have other meat to kill. but even those few wouldnt go.

besides, my experience with high % jewels is that the blue stats are a b|tch to add ie int2 str1 freeze5% burn3%...familiar?

ok, im just consoling myself lol. anyway, i wish the new owner all the best in pimping it up.
